Roger Bilodeau

Lawyer

Roger Bilodeau is a native of Ste-Agathe, Manitoba. He has been admitted to the law societies of Manitoba, New Brunswick and Ontario and has practiced law in English and French in those three jurisdictions at different intervals between 1981 and 2020.

He was also a professor of law at the Faculté de droit de l’Université de Moncton from 1984 to 1999. From 1999 to 2003, he had the privilege of serving as Deputy Attorney General and Deputy Minister of Justice for New Brunswick.

From March 2009 to May 2020, he occupied the position of Registrar of the Supreme Court of Canada. S

ince June 2020, he works on a part-time basis as an arbitrator and legal consultant, both in Canada and abroad.
